Advertisement
believe_me

Untitled

May 18th, 2022
1,421
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. procedure deleteSubscriber(NumberOfSubscriber: TNumber);
  2. const
  3.     DELETER: ansichar = '/';
  4. var
  5.     SourceFile: TBinaryFile;
  6.     Offset: integer;
  7.     NumberOfRecord: LongWord;
  8.     ArrayOfRecordNumber: TNumber;
  9.     DeleterArray: array[1..RECORD_SIZE] of ansichar;
  10. begin
  11.     fillchar(DeleterArray, RECORD_SIZE, DELETER);
  12.     assign(SourceFile, getCurrentDir + '\' + FILE_NAME);
  13.     reset(SourceFile);
  14.     Offset := NumberOfSubscriber * RECORD_SIZE;
  15.     seek(SourceFile, Offset);
  16.     blockWrite(SourceFile, DeleterArray, RECORD_SIZE);
  17.     closeFile(SourceFile);
  18. end;
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ement